Kim Ji Hoon joins Kim Tae Hee and Park Hae Soo in Amazon Prime's new series "Butterfly."

Exciting news from the world of Amazon Prime! Kim Ji Hoon is set to join the stellar cast of “Butterfly,” the upcoming thriller series based on a popular graphic novel.

Announced by Big Picture ENT on April 19, Kim Ji Hoon’s participation adds to the anticipation surrounding this intriguing project.

“Butterfly” revolves around David Jung (portrayed by Daniel Dae Kim), a former U.S. intelligence agent whose life is upended by a fateful decision. Caught in a perilous game of pursuit and evasion, David finds himself entangled with Rebecca, a current agent tasked with eliminating him.

Produced by Daniel Dae Kim, “Butterfly” promises gripping storytelling and high-stakes action across six thrilling episodes set in Korea.

Kim Tae Hee and Park Hae Soo were previously confirmed for the series in January, adding further excitement to the ensemble. Details regarding their roles are eagerly awaited as the series gears up for production.
